02 — Research
From experimental 300 GHz THz links to neuromorphic photonics. Building the physical layer of 6G.
Experimental 300 GHz (WR-3) transmission systems built on photonic upconversion, from PIN-photodiode transmitters to receiver-side DSP. Demonstrated throughputs beyond 200 Gbit/s, with a record 221 Gb/s dual-polarisation link over 500 m.
Rate-adaptive probabilistic shaping approaching the Shannon limit, integrated into converged fiber–THz backhaul architectures for 6G. The subject of my PhD dissertation at TU Berlin.
Optical signal processing on integrated photonic chips using neural networks: modulation format identification, signal correction, and feature extraction, entirely in the optical domain at sub-nanosecond latency.
03 — Venture
Co-Founder & CEO of an early-stage deep-tech venture, developed at Fraunhofer HHI, working to reinvent the optical transceiver for AI data centers.
“Becoming the secret sauce of next-gen transceivers.”
LUXONNIC is developing the LUXONNICore, a photonic integrated circuit that performs signal equalization directly in the optical domain using photonic neural networks, replacing the power-hungry DSP chips inside next-generation (LPO/CPO) transceivers.
